DTC P0645: | A/C Compressor Clutch Relay Circuit Open |
1. | Turn the ignition switch ON (II). |
2. | Clear the DTC with the HDS. |
3. | Do the A/C CLUTCH ON/OFF in the INSPECTION MENU with the HDS. |
4. | Check for Temporary DTCs or DTCs with the HDS. Is DTC P0645 indicated? YES - Go to 5. NO - Intermittent failure, system is OK at this time. Check for poor connections or loose terminals at the A/C compressor clutch relay and the ECM.n |
5. | Turn the ignition switch OFF. |
6. | Disconnect the A/C compressor clutch relay in the under-hood fuse/relay box. |
7. | Turn the ignition switch ON (II). |
8. | Measure voltage between A/C compressor clutch relay 4P connector terminal No. 4 and body ground.
Is there battery voltage? YES - Go to 9. NO - Repair open in the wire between the A/C compressor clutch relay and the No. 36 IG2 HAC (A/C) (10 A) fuse in the under-dash fuse/relay box, then go to 14. |
9. | Check the A/C compressor clutch relay. Is the A/C compressor clutch relay OK? YES - Go to 10. NO - Replace the A/C compressor clutch relay, then go to 14. |
10. | Turn the ignition switch OFF, and wait 1 minute. |
11. | Reconnect the A/C compressor clutch relay. |
12. | Disconnect ECM connector No. 2 (58P). |
13. | Measure voltage between ECM connector No. 2 terminal No. 45 and body ground.
Is there battery voltage? YES - Go to 19. NO - Repair open in the wire between the A/C compressor clutch relay and ECM connector No. 2 terminal No. 45, then go to 14. |
14. | Reconnect all connectors. |
15. | Turn the ignition switch ON (II). |
16. | Reset the ECM with the HDS. |
17. | Do the A/C CLUTCH ON/OFF in the INSPECTION MENU with the HDS. |
18. | Check for Temporary DTCs or DTCs with the HDS. Are any Temporary DTCs or DTCs indicated? YES - If DTC P0645 is indicated, check for poor connections or loose terminals at the A/C compressor clutch relay and the ECM, then go to 1. If any other Temporary DTCs or DTCs are indicated, go to the indicated DTC's troubleshooting. NO - Troubleshooting is complete.n |
19. | Update the ECM if it does not have the latest software, or substitute a known-good ECM. |
20. | Do the A/C CLUTCH ON/OFF in the INSPECTION MENU with the HDS. |
21. | Check for Temporary DTCs or DTCs with the HDS. Are any Temporary DTCs or DTCs indicated? YES - If DTC P0645 is indicated, check for poor connections or loose terminals at the A/C compressor clutch relay and the ECM, then go to 1. If any other Temporary DTCs or DTCs are indicated, go to the indicated DTC's troubleshooting. NO - If the ECM was updated, troubleshooting is complete. If the ECM was substituted, replace the original ECM.n |
